About this business

Shinsei, famous for its interactive sushi bar, is run by the renowned duoTracy Rathbun and Lynae Fearing. The contemporary restaurant was designed with a Texas flair and incorporates bright colors in green and yellow hues. With the addition of habanero mayonnaise, Maui onions, hibiscus vinegar, and jalapenos, these peppy creations add a kick to the normal sushi rolls. Celebrity chef spouses Tracy Rathbun and Lynae Fearing operate this pan-Asian fusion restaurant and sushi bar near Park Cities. – The Scene Contemporary paintings, mid-century-mod fixtures and a daring forest-green-acid-yellow-taupe color scheme lend drama to an essentially homey restaurant. Photos of the Rathbun and Fearing kids adorn a rear wall. Quotes and original artwork memorialize late local artist Scott Barber. An upstairs lounge accommodates overflow from the main dining room.
